This macro introduces the possibility to suggest the compiler that a
data member doesn't need an address different from other non static
data members.
The usage of a macro is to maintain portability since at the moment
the attribute [[no_unique_address]] is only supported by clang
with at least -std=c++11 but it should be supported by all the
compilers starting from C++20.

RequestEncoderFallback, RequestEncoderSwitch and
SetVideoCodecSwitchingEnabledRequest are now all called on the
worker thread. Before, the work already happened on that thread but
WebRtcVideoChannel adapted internally when needed.
With this CL, there are thread checks to make sure that these calls are
always made the same way, we don't need the async invoker and there
are fewer calls out from the encoder thread in VideoStreamEncoder
(reducing the chance of unintentional blocking).

As documented in webrtc:11908 this cleanup is fairly invasive and
when a part of a frequently executed code path, can be quite costly
in terms of performance overhead. This is currently the case with
synchronous calls between threads (Thread) as well with our proxy
api classes.
With this CL, all code in WebRTC should now either be using MessageHandlerAutoCleanup
or calling MessageHandler(false) explicitly.
Next steps will be to update external code to either depend on the
AutoCleanup variant, or call MessageHandler(false).
Changing the proxy classes to use TaskQueue set of concepts instead of
MessageHandler. This avoids the perf overhead related to the cleanup
above as well as incompatibility with the thread policy checks in
Thread that some current external users of the proxies would otherwise
run into (if we were to use Thread::Send() for synchronous call).
Following this we'll move the cleanup step into the AutoCleanup class
and an RTC_DCHECK that all calls to the MessageHandler are setting
the flag to false, before eventually removing the flag and make
MessageHandler pure virtual.
